119th CONGRESS 1st Session |
To amend title 23, United States Code, to provide for a reduced Federal share for a State that employs a safe routes to school coordinator.
June 11, 2025
Ms. Scholten (for herself and Mr. Bresnahan) introduced the following bill; which was referred to the Committee on Transportation and Infrastructure
To amend title 23, United States Code, to provide for a reduced Federal share for a State that employs a safe routes to school coordinator.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led,
This Act may be cited as the “Kids on the Go Act of 2025”.
SEC. 2. Safe routes to school coordinator.
Section 208(g)(3) of title 23, United States Code, is amended—
(1) by striking “Each State shall” and inserting “(A) In general.—Each State shall”; and
(2) by adding at the end the following:
